1 |
Problem |
Simplify the expression \$ (8xy) + (3yx) \$. |
|
2 |
Step |
Given expression |
\$ (8xy) + (3yx) \$ |
3 |
Step |
Identify Like Terms: Determine which terms in the expression involve the same variable(s) raised to the same power(s) |
\$ (8xy) \$ and \$ (3yx) \$ |
4 |
Step |
Combine Like Terms: Add or subtract the coefficients of like terms while keeping the variables unchanged |
\$ (8xy) + (3yx) \$ ⇒ (8 + 3)xy ⇒ 11xy |
5 |
Solution |
The simplified expression is11xy. |
